Timezone in Meredith
Meredith, located in New Hampshire, is in the America/New_York timezone, which has a UTC offset of -5 hours during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, typically from the second Sunday in March to the first Sunday in November, the offset changes to -4 hours. This means that clocks are set forward one hour in spring and set back one hour in fall, allowing for more daylight during the evening hours.

Attractions and Activities in Meredith
Meredith, located in New Hampshire, is known for its picturesque setting on the shores of Lake Winnipesaukee, the largest lake in the state. This charming town offers a variety of outdoor activities, making it a popular destination for both summer and winter tourism. Visitors can enjoy boating, fishing, and swimming in the warmer months, while the winter brings opportunities for ice fishing, snowmobiling, and skiing in the nearby mountains.
Culturally, Meredith hosts several events throughout the year, including the annual Meredith Village Savings Bank Ice Fishing Derby and the popular Lakes Region Craft Fair. The town features a quaint village atmosphere with unique shops, art galleries, and local dining options. The surrounding natural beauty, characterized by rolling hills and vibrant foliage in the fall, enhances its appeal, drawing n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ts alike.
Meredithβs location also serves as a gateway to exploring the larger Lakes Region of New Hampshire, which is rich in recreational opportunities and scenic landscapes.
Practical Information for Visitors
Meredith, located in New Hampshire, is best accessed by car, as it does not have a major airport. The closest airport is Manchester-Boston Regional Airport, about an hour away. For train travel, the nearest Amtrak station is in Concord, roughly 30 miles from Meredith.
Local bus services are limited, so renting a car or using rideshares is advisable for easy exploration. The weather in Meredith varies significantly throughout the year. Summers are warm and pleasant, with temperatures reaching the 80s Fahrenheit, while winters can be quite cold, with temperatures often dropping below freezing.
The fall foliage is particularly stunning, attracting many visitors. The best time to visit Meredith is during late spring or early autumn, when the weather is mild and the natural scenery is at its peak.
